On the growth rate of periodic orbits for vector fields

Dynamical Systems 2017-09-21 v1

Abstract

We establish the relationship between the growth rate of periodic orbits and the topological entropy for C1C^1 generic vector fields: this extends a classical result of Katok for C1+α(α>0)C^{1+\alpha}(\alpha>0) surface diffeomorphisms to C1C^1 generic vector fields of any dimension. The main difficulty comes from the existence of singularities and the shear of the flow.
